Variety Asia reports that the Golden Compass earned 2.5m USD (Y270m) this past weekend at advanced screenings in Japan this weekend. Audience demographics exceeded expectations drawing in not only families but teens and fans in their fifties and sixties. Although the Japanese distributor Gaga has not released their own box office projections, Variety calculates: “A straight line B.O. projection would be $51 million — not “Harry Potter” territory, but not bad for a pic that finished in the US with $70 million.” This estimate would set worldwide box office gross to 380m USD according to Box Office Mojo’s numbers. The Golden Compass opens in Japan to 700 screens this weekend.
